Ft. Clinch State Park

Fort Clinch is a fort that was built in the Civil War era. There was only one battle fought in the state of Florida (Olustee) during the Civil War. The state park also has the usual recreational areas....fishing pier, campgrounds, beach, picnic ground, bicycle trails, etc. On this particular June day, it was very HOT!
